1. Information We Collect and Store
Orbit Catch does not require an account, registration, or any personally identifiable information (such as your name, email, or exact physical location).
All game-related progress and preferences are stored strictly locally on your device (via Android SharedPreferences), including:
- Gameplay Records: High scores and the Top 3 Leaderboard.
- Player Preferences: Audio settings (sound effects, ambient music), haptic vibration toggle, and selected difficulty level.
This data never leaves your device and is not transmitted to any external servers hosted by RZ code.
2. Third-Party Services and Advertising
To support the development and provide the game for free, Orbit Catch integrates trusted third-party services that may collect standard diagnostic and device data:
- Google AdMob (Google LLC): Used to display banner advertisements and voluntary Rewarded Video ads (the "Second Chance" revive feature). Google AdMob may process device identifiers, advertising IDs (AAID), and performance metrics to serve ads.
- Google User Messaging Platform (UMP SDK): Used to manage privacy choices, consent, and GDPR/RODO compliance for users in applicable regions.
For more details on how Google processes data, please refer to Google’s Privacy & Terms.

Information We Collect
FlagMaster Quiz collects a very limited amount of information, solely for the purpose of personalizing your gameplay experience:
- Player Nickname: The app prompts you to enter a nickname. This name is chosen by you and is used only for display purposes within the game (e.g., on the Settings and Results screens). We do not ask for, collect, or store your real name or any other personally identifiable information.
- Game Statistics: The app records your game performance data, such as total games played, scores, and accuracy percentages for different game modes.
How We Use and Store Your Information
All information collected by FlagMaster Quiz is stored locally on your device only.
- No Data Transmission: We do not transmit, upload, or share your Player Nickname or your Game Statistics with our servers or any third-party services. The data never leaves your phone.
- Internal Use Only: The information is used exclusively within the app to provide you with features like seeing your name in the settings and tracking your high scores and performance on the statistics screen.
Data Sources & Disclaimer
- Flag Images: The flag images used in this app are sourced via the public CDN at
https://flagcdn.com/.
- Geographical Data: Country names, capitals, and continent information are primarily sourced from public, community-driven knowledge bases like Wikipedia.
- Disclaimer: This data is provided for educational and entertainment purposes only. While every effort is made to ensure its accuracy, the information was gathered during the development phase and may not be 100% accurate or up-to-date. No guarantee of correctness is given.
